Kernel 5.9 zone descriptor interface adds the new zone capacity field defining
the range of sectors usable within a zone. This patch series adds support for
this new field. This series depends on recent changes in blkzone and fio to
support zone capacity.
The first patch modifies the helper function _get_blkzone_report() to obtain
zone capacity of the test target zones. Following three patches adjust test
cases in zbd group for zone capacity. The last patch fixes a test condition
issue found in this work.
